Overview""What to Eat: In Health and Disease"" is a comprehensive exploration of nutrition and dietetics written by Benjamin Harrow. This work examines the critical role that food plays in maintaining physical health and managing various medical conditions. Written at a time when the science of nutrition was rapidly evolving, the book delves into the essential elements of a balanced diet, including proteins, fats, carbohydrates, and the then-novel discovery of vitamins. Harrow provides a clear and scientific approach to eating, offering practical guidance for the layperson and the professional alike. The text covers how specific foods affect the human body and offers dietary recommendations tailored to both healthy individuals and those struggling with illness. By emphasizing the chemical and biological foundations of what we consume, ""What to Eat: In Health and Disease"" stands as a significant historical contribution to the field of health science, highlighting the transition from traditional eating habits to a more rigorous, evidence-based understanding of human nutrition.
